Husband Wants Kidney Back from Wife



GARDEN CITY, N.Y. (AP/ WCBS 880)  -- A New York doctor is demanding that his estranged wife pay him $1.5 million to compensate him for the kidney he gave her while they were still on good terms.
    
WCBS Reporter Sophia Hall talks with Dr. Richard Batista about why he wants the kidney back.

"She had an affair, then would not reconcile, then handed me divorce papers as I was going into surgery trying to save another person's life," said Batista. 
   
He said he gave his kidney to Dawnell Batista in June 2001. She filed for divorce in July 2005.
   
The 49-year-old Batista works for Nassau University Medical Center. The couple have three children, ages, 8, 11 and 14.
   
A message left for his wife's attorney, Douglas Rothkopf, was not immediately returned.
